Surrender

I do not claim to know why,
          but strive to do what’s honorable, honest and good.
I do not know why I am so driven to do what’s good,
          but it is part of my cellular make-up
                    that is outside my realm of consciousness and understanding.
I strive to understand why most people are not driven to do good and be honest, support, sincere.
 
Has our world made us so cyncical and insecure, that we simply cannot trust what we instinctlively know is right and good?
It seems ego and self-importance is more important then generousity, kindness and friendship.
 
I mourn the loss of these values in the world.
 
I surrender the expectation that others will respond in good ways.
 
Regardless, I will continue to
     be kind to all friends and strangers,
     be supportive and helpful to all those in need
     be generous in spirit and love to all.
These values I cannot surrender.
